BOILED FRUIT CAKE

225 grams Butter or Margarine
1 cup Sugar
1 packet Mixed Fruit
1 packet Glace Cherries
2 teaspoons Mixed Spice
1 teaspoon Carb Soda
1 cup Water

2 Eggs
2 tablespoons Treacle
1 cup Plain Flour
1 cup Self Raising Flour


Place all ingredients from Butter/Margarine through to Water into a saucepan and bring to the boil.
Allow to cool

Fold beaten eggs into the above mix.
Add Flours and Treacle and mix well so it is thoroughly combined (just use a wooden spoon to do this, no mixer required)

Pour mixture into a well greased/lined tin and cook at 160 degrees Celsius for approximately 1 1/2 hours.





This cake keeps well and is lovely and moist with a lovely light flavour.
